Kung Fu Panda video game - Fact Sheet


Kung Fu Panda - Fact Sheet

In the Kung Fu Panda video game, players embark on an epic, action-packed adventure as they master the specialized Kung Fu fighting styles of Po the Panda, the unlikely hero, and experience the unique skills of his teacher Shifu and the legendary Kung Fu masters, the Furious Five: Monkey, Tigress, Viper, Mantis and Crane. Through 13 legendary levels from the movie and beyond, and spanning land, water and air, players must work their way to become the Dragon Warrior and defeat the ultimate enemy, Tai Lung, as they battle a variety of foes, overcome dangerous obstacles, navigate multi-tiered environments and solve challenging puzzles. Featuring a deep variety of gameplay, unique co-op and competitive multiplayer games, collectibles, and a host of character upgrades, the Kung Fu Panda video game provides an experience gamers of all ages will enjoy.



KEY FEATURES:


Kung Fu Awesomeness – Players embark on a legendary journey to fulfill Po’s destiny to become the Dragon Warrior. Learn and master Po, Shifu and the Furious Five’s specialized Kung Fu fighting styles, abilities and upgrades in order to defeat formidable bosses like the Great Gorilla, the Wolf Sergeant and the ultimate enemy, Tai Lung.

Bodacious Humor – Kung Fu Panda’s unique brand of humor, quick-witted dialogue and hilarious situations bring the game to life for players of all ages to enjoy.

Play as all Your Favorite Characters
– Gamers learn to utilize the special abilities and combat skills of Po, Shifu, Monkey, Tigress, Viper, Crane and Mantis. As gameplay progresses, unlock and experience each character’s special moves and upgrades.

• Master Po’s signature “Panda Style” maneuvers, including the Panda Quake, Panda Stumble and Iron Belly Blast. Plus earn awesome Kung Fu upgrades increasing Po’s strength, speed and agility, as he progresses from the unlikely hero to the powerful Dragon Warrior.
• Play as Po’s teacher, Shifu, the quick, agile and impressively skilled Kung Fu master. Players make use of Shifu’s wisdom and speed to perfect his whirlwind techniques.
• Take control of the daring Tigress, and utilize her fluid and powerful moves focusing on fast, stylized combat that allows gamers to master the Leaping Force and Tiger Charge maneuvers.
• Monkey’s spring-loaded tail attacks and explosive style make him one of the fastest Kung Fu masters around. His acrobatic abilities will let players execute a variety of lightening-fast platforming moves.
• Viper’s snake-like stealth abilities allow gamers to utilize her stealth abilities to pull off such moves as the Umbrella, Enemy Taxi and Choking Coil attacks.
• Players will soar with Crane’s Surface-to-Air Attacks using his graceful and light footed movements, which allow them to Fly, Glide and Swoop.
• Although the smallest of the Furious Five, Mantis’ super strength, strong grab maneuvers and super quick burst moves will allow players to deliver powerful and paralyzing strikes to foes.

Relive the Movie and Go Beyond With Exclusive Content
– Experience favorite moments based on the film and discover never-before-seen, game-exclusive content co-created by DreamWorks Animation and Activision including a variety of environments, such as the mystical Lotus Lake, and characters, like the baddest ninja cats around, the Wu Sisters.

Experience 13 Legendary Levels – Players traverse 13 multi-stage levels from the movie and beyond, spanning air, water and land, to battle a variety of foes, overcome dangerous obstacles, navigate multi-tiered environments and solve challenging puzzles.

Join friends in multi-player action and co-op mode
– Gamers can go head-to-head against friends across a wide variety of battle arenas with their favorite characters including Po and the Furious Five, Tai Lung, the ferocious Ox and others. Players can also team up in cooperative mode to work through a series of unique challenges and defeat dangerous enemies.

Publisher: Activision, Inc.

Developer:
Luxoflux (PS3 and Xbox 360) Xpec (Wii and PS2) Beenox (Games for Windows / PC) Vicarious Visions (NDS)

Release Date: June 3, 2008

Platforms: PlayStation 2 computer entertainment system/PlayStation 3 computer entertainment system/Xbox 360 video game system from Microsoft/Wii /Nintendo DS/Games for Windows PC

Suggested Retail Price: $49.99 (PS3, Xbox 360, Wii) $39.99 (PS2) $29.99 (NDS) $19.99 (PC)

Call of Duty - World at War video game - Fact Sheet


Call of Duty - World at War - Fact Sheet

FACT SHEET FOR ALL VERSIONS

Building on the Call of Duty 4 engine, Call of Duty: World at War thrusts players into the ruthless and gritty chaos of WWII combat like never been before, and challenges them to band together to survive the most harrowing and climactic battles of WWII that led to the demise of the Axis powers on the European and South Pacific fronts. 

The title re-defines WWII games by offering an uncensored experience with unique enemies and combat variety, including Kamikaze fighters, ambush attacks, Banzai charges and cunning cover tactics, as well as explosive on-screen action through all new cooperative gameplay.



KEY FEATURES:
Call of Duty 4 Technology – Built using the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are engine, Call of Duty: World at War utilizes a bedrock of technology that delivers jaw-dropping visuals, while empowering players to employ elements like fire to affect the dynamics of the battlefield. Players that attempt to harness the power of new weapons, like the flamethrower, will find themselves capable of burning away environmental elements that give cover to a camouflaged enemy, leaving a charred battlefield – and their foes – in their wake.

Coordinated Assault and Support – For the first time in the franchise, Call of Duty: World at War introduces co-op, bringing fresh meaning to the “No One Fights Alone” mantra. Call of Duty: World at War co-op features up to four-players online, or two-player local split-screen, allowing gamers to experience harrowing single-player missions together for greater camaraderie and tactical execution. The title also incorporates traditional multiplayer components such as challenges, rankings and online stats into the co-op campaign for deeper re-playability and advanced gameplay..

New Theaters of Operation – Players fight as U.S. Marines and Russian soldiers facing enemies – some new to the Call of Duty franchise – that employ lethal new tactics and know no fear, no mercy, nor the rules of war. Epic conflicts are fought on multiple fronts, playing through the climactic battles of WWII in the grittiest, most chaotic and cinematically intense experience to date.

Innovative Multiplayer – Multiplayer builds from the success of Call of Duty delivering a persistent online experience for more squad based interaction. New development with party systems allows an intimacy with squad based combat never before seen in Call of Duty. Combined infantry and vehicle missions add a new dimension to the online warfare and offers more PERK abilities.

Cinematic Quality Graphics and Sound – Treyarch’s award-winning sound department returns with effects that add to the already immersive cinematic intensity of the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are game engine.
Publisher: Activision Publishing, Inc.
Developer: Treyarch
Release Date: Fall 2008
Platforms: Xbox 360 video game and entertainment system from Microsoft
PLAYSTATION 3 computer entertainment system
Windows PC and Games for Windows, Nintendo Wii, Nintendo DS, PlayStation 2 computer entertainment system

The Sims 3 video game out Feb 2009


Also Available February 20, 2009 The Sims 3 Collector's Edition to Include an Iconic The Sims Plumbob USB Drive, Exclusive In-Game Content and More!

The Sims 3, the highly anticipated next-generation flagship PC game from The Sims Label, will be available at retailers worldwide and available by digital download on February 20, 2009. The freedom of The Sims 3 will inspire you with endless creative possibilities and amuse you with unexpected moments of surprise and mischief. The feature-set includes a new seamless, open neighborhood, new Create-a-Sim, new unique personality traits, new unlimited customization and new gameplay that's quick and rewarding.
The Sims 3 Collector's Edition will also be in stores on February 20, 2009. The Sims 3 Collector's Edition will include the full game along with additional collectable The Sims merchandise and a bonus in-game Italian-Style Sports Car unavailable elsewhere. A limited number of copies of The Sims 3 Collector's Edition will be available worldwide, and those who pre-order the product from select retailers will receive an additional exclusive in-game vintage sports car and a collectible poster that is a first look at the neighborhood, all available while supplies last.



"I'm excited to get the next-generation flagship PC game from The Sims Label, The Sims 3, into player's hands worldwide on February 20," said Rod Humble, Head of The Sims Studio. "The Sims 3 Collector's Edition, launching on the same day, will offer a very special Sims experience to our loyal players."
The Sims 3 features a brand new engine that allows you to immerse your unique Sims in an open living neighborhood where they can roam and explore all new surroundings including the beach, mountains and town center. The neighborhood is alive and constantly evolving so what happens to a Sim on one side of the neighborhood could impact your Sims on the other side of town! If your Sims are in the right place at the right time, who knows what might happen? And now for the first time, your Sims have distinctive personalities thanks to a range of all-new personality traits. You have the option to select from dozens of personality traits such as brave, artistic, kleptomaniac, clumsy, paranoid and romantic. Combine up to five traits to create an endless number of truly diverse individuals.
The all-new Create-a-Sim allows you to completely customize your Sims' appearances making every Sim unique. The feature is easy-to-use and more powerful than ever, letting you fine-tune every aspect of your Sims face, customize their hair color, select the exact shade of their skin tone and determine much more to make lifelike Sims. It's never been easier to make Sims that are thin, full-figured or muscular and everything in between! In true The Sims fashion, you can customize everything. The Sims 3 allows for infinite possibilities to design the interior and exterior of your Sims surroundings.

Additionally, you can enjoy the challenge of short-term and long-term goals and then reap the rewards! Based on personality traits, skills and career choices, your Sims have short and long term Wishes that provide constant fun challenges, things to do and achieve. You have the ultimate freedom to choose whether to fulfill their destiny, giving them lifetime happiness and rewards or not! Will your Sim skyrocket from latrine cleaner to an astronaut, go from being a rabid fan to a sports legend or will you choose an alternate destiny? In The Sims 3, life is what you make it!

The Sims 3 Collector's Edition will include:
· The Sims 3 Game for PC
· The Sims Plumbob USB Drive with matching Green Carabiner
· Exclusive In-Game Italian-Style Sports Car
· Tips and hints guide
· The Sims 3 Plumbob Stickers

Resident Evil 5 video game Xbox and PS3 - Fact Sheet


Resident Evil 5 - Fact Sheet



The biohazard threat has not ended: Just when it seemed that the menace of Resident Evil had been destroyed, along comes a new terror to send shivers down player's spines. Chris Redfield, returning Resident Evil hero, has followed the path of the evil literally around the globe. After joining a new organization, Chris heads to Africa where the latest bioterrorism threat is literally transforming the people and animals of the city into mindless, maddened creatures.

He is joined by a new partner, Sheva Alomar, who lends her strength, intelligence and sharp-shooting skills to the mission. In order to survive, Chris and Sheva must work together to take on the challenges of discovering the truth behind this evil plot. Utilising a revolutionary new co-op mode of gameplay, players will be able to assume control of either Chris or Sheva and experience Resident Evil in new ways. In Resident Evil 5, Capcom will have players fearing the daylight as much as they have feared shadow in previous games.



Co-producers and series veterans Jun Takeuchi (Lost Planet) and Masachicka Kawata (Resident Evil 4 Wii Edition, Resident Evil: The Umbrella Chronicles) unleash an unprecedented level of fear for the next generation in Resident Evil 5, the sequel to one of the highest-rated videogames in history, according to Metacritic.com and Gamerankings.com.

Promising to revolutionise the series by delivering an unbelievable level of detail, realism and control, Resident Evil 5 is certain to bring new fans to the series. New technology developed specifically for the game, as well as incredible changes to both the gameplay and world of Resident Evil will make this a must-have game for gamers across the globe.

The Resident Evil series has sold over 34 million units since the original game was released in 1996 and has spawned a multi-million dollar trilogy of films from Sony Pictures. Resident Evil 5 will revolutionise the Resident Evil series, just as Resident Evil 4 did.

Features
  • Chris Redfield, protagonist of the original Resident Evil and Resident Evil: Code Veronica, returns

  • Chris is joined by new character Sheva Alomar, an African special agent tasked with investigating the epidemic

  • 2 player co-op online gameplay means that players are not alone in their fight against the horror lurking around every corner

  • Simultaneous Pan Western release date for both P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 on March 13, 2009

  • New enemies bring new challenges: speed and intelligence make adversaries as dangerous singly as they are in groups.

  • An arsenal of weapons at the player's command to keep the evil at bay, including knives, pistols, machine guns, sniper rifles and more.

  • Lighting effects provide a new level of suspense in both harsh light and deepest shadow

  • True high definition gaming on multiple game platforms, using an advanced version of Capcom's proprietary game engine, MT Framework, which powered the next-gen, million-plus hit titles Devil May Cry 4, Lost Planet and Dead Rising.
Release Date: March 13, 2009
Genre: Survival Horror
Platform: PlayStation 3, Xbox 360
Developer: Capcom
